This refreshing and tangy Spicy Pickled Plum Cucumber Salad is a vibrant side dish bursting with bold flavors. Crisp cucumbers are lightly salted to draw out excess moisture, then tossed in a zesty sauce featuring minced garlic, fresh chili peppers, and tangy pickled plum. The umami-rich dressing—a mix of soy sauce, oyster sauce, white vinegar, sugar, and chili oil—creates a perfect balance of sweet, spicy, and savory. Chilled to perfection, this salad offers a satisfying crunch with every bite, making it an ideal accompaniment to grilled meats or a light standalone snack. The unique addition of pickled plum adds a delightful sour note, elevating this simple dish into something extraordinary. Instructions

Step 1
Cucumber is lightly rubbed with salt on the surface, then rinsed clean. Cut off both ends, split into four long strips along the section, remove the seeds, and use a knife to loosen and cut into segments. Add salt and mix well, marinate for about 10-15 minutes.

Step 2
Garlic is minced, fresh chili peppers are cut into small pieces, and pickled plum is pitted and minced. Soy sauce, oyster sauce, white vinegar, sugar, and chicken powder are mixed in a small bowl until the sugar dissolves, then add the plum paste, garlic, and chili pepper, and drizzle with chili oil to make the sauce.

Step 3
The cucumber’s marinating liquid is discarded, and the prepared sauce is poured over and mixed well. After chilling in the refrigerator, it is ready to serve.
